Losses in the Nigerian Distribution Systems: A review of classification and strategies for mitigation

Power Distribution systems are prone to losses, be it technical or non-technical. These losses affect the efficiency, revenue, and expansion capacity of the system among others. The losses are mitigate-able though cannot be eliminated. In the case of the Nigerian distribution systems, these losses are abnormally high with detrimental consequences on the effective operation of the system. Thus this study is aimed at classifying and suggesting possible mitigation strategies for minimizing losses in the Nigerian distribution network.
